Amendment Since initial award the total obligations have decreased 78% from $5,400,645 to $1,211,989.
Washington State Department Of Natural Resources was awarded
Central Cascade Ecoregion Phase 2: Research Conservation & Engagement
Project Grant F22AP00278
worth $908,316
from Fish and Wildlife Service Region 1: Pacific in October 2021 with work to be completed primarily in Washington United States.
The grant
has a duration of 3 years and
was awarded through assistance program 15.615 Cooperative Endangered Species Conservation Fund.
$303,673 (25.0%) of this Project Grant was funded by non-federal sources.
The Project Grant was awarded through grant opportunity Cooperative Endangered Species Conservation Fund: Habitat Conservation Plan Land Acquisition Grants.
